Bit The Inside Of My Cheek. Now Have Swelling. What To Do?
I bit my the inside of my cheek multiple times for the past two days and now it looks like a huge ulcer on the inside of my mouth and keeps getting larger every time I accidentally bit it. And my whole left cheek has become swellen along with my lymph nodes... What can I do to make the swelling go down and make the pain stop? Should I go into the dr?
Hello,
Thanks for posting on HCM,
Given that they are a lot of pathologic bacteria found in the mouth, it is very likely that the multiple bites have been complicated by an infection which as resulted into a mouth ulcer. You will require a course of local and systemic antibiotics (to use in mouth and swallow respectively) and also pain killers (analgesic). Mouth wash solutions with antibacterial infects such as eludril or hextril could be used. Analgesia such as paracetamol could take care of the pain.
You will need to see a doctor to examine you closely and prescribe the necessary antibiotics.
You need to be careful now as mouth ulcers can complicate seriously.
